The Rajasthan Lokayukta has disposed 4,990 complaints out of the total 6,485 it received between April 1, 2015, and March 31, 2016.

The maximum complaints, 1,057, were against the Urban Development and Housing, and Local Self Governance Department, Lokayukta S S Kothari said.

There were 1,025 complaints against the Revenue Department, 929 against the police, 854 against the Mines Department and 695 against the Rural Development and Panchayti Raj Department, Kothari said .

The Lokyukta also took suo-moto cognizance of media reports in 39 cases.

Kothari presented the report to Governor Kalyan Singh today, a release said.
